在网页设计中,页面关闭功能是一个常见的需求。使用jQuery可以轻松实现这一功能,让用户能够更加便捷地关闭不需要的页面或弹窗。本文将详细介绍如何使用jQuery实现页面关闭功能,并提供一些实用的技巧和...
在网页设计中,页面关闭功能是一个常见的需求。使用jQuery可以轻松实现这一功能,让用户能够更加便捷地关闭不需要的页面或弹窗。本文将详细介绍如何使用jQuery实现页面关闭功能,并提供一些实用的技巧和代码示例。
jQuery提供了一个简单的.close()方法,可以用来关闭页面或弹窗。这个方法通常绑定到一个关闭按钮上,当用户点击这个按钮时,页面或弹窗将被关闭。
首先,我们需要一个关闭按钮,通常是一个元素。以下是基本的HTML结构:
接下来,我们需要编写jQuery代码来处理关闭操作。以下是实现页面关闭功能的代码示例:
在上面的代码中,我们首先引入了jQuery库。然后,在文档加载完成后,我们为ID为closeBtn的按钮添加了一个点击事件监听器。当按钮被点击时,window.close()方法会被调用,从而关闭当前页面或弹窗。
需要注意的是,window.close()方法在某些浏览器中可能不会正常工作,尤其是当页面是通过点击链接或脚本自动打开的情况下。在这种情况下,我们可以使用以下方法来确保关闭功能:
在上面的代码中,我们使用了try...catch语句来捕获可能出现的错误,并给出相应的提示。
如果你需要关闭特定的窗口,而不是当前窗口,可以使用window.opener属性。以下是一个示例:
在上面的代码中,我们首先检查window.opener是否存在,如果存在,则调用其close()方法来关闭窗口。
如果你想关闭所有打开的弹窗,可以使用以下方法:
在上面的代码中,我们遍历window.open数组,并调用每个窗口的close()方法来关闭它们。
使用jQuery实现页面关闭功能是一个简单而有效的方法。通过上述步骤和技巧,你可以轻松地实现这一功能,并确保它在各种情况下都能正常工作。希望本文能帮助你更好地理解和应用jQuery页面关闭技巧。